Growing in business doesn't always come with big announcements or sudden success. Sometimes the signs that you're moving up are small, but important. Here’s how you can tell that you’re leveling up in business:
1. You’re Okay With Being Uncomfortable
One big sign of growth is getting comfortable with discomfort. Instead of avoiding hard situations, you face them head-on. Whether it's tough clients, big decisions, or taking risks, you’re learning that feeling uneasy is part of growth.

2. Your Network Is Growing
As you grow in business, your circle of contacts expands. You start meeting people who inspire and challenge you. You also find yourself connecting with those who have a similar mindset and push you to improve.

3. You Think More About Strategy, Not Just Tasks
In the beginning, you may have focused on getting things done. But as you elevate, you start thinking more strategically. You focus on the bigger picture, delegate tasks, and prioritize long-term goals.

4. Opportunities Are Coming to You
As you grow, new opportunities begin to come your way. This happens because of the work you’ve put in, and the reputation you’re building. People start reaching out to you for partnerships, clients, and other business opportunities.

5. You Focus More on Value Than Money
Making money is important, but real growth happens when you prioritize offering value. You start focusing on helping your customers solve problems rather than just trying to make sales. This leads to long-term success.

6. You Handle Setbacks Better
When you're elevating in business, failures or challenges don't knock you down as much. You start to see them as learning experiences rather than roadblocks. You get back up quickly and keep moving forward.

7. Your Personal Growth Matches Your Business Growth
Business growth often goes hand-in-hand with personal growth. As your business improves, you’re likely working on yourself too—whether it’s learning new skills, building confidence, or improving your mindset.

8. You Have a Clear Purpose
As you elevate, your understanding of why you're in business becomes stronger. You have a clearer vision of your mission and values. Your purpose drives your decisions and actions.
